TO-MORROW'S PROGRAMME.

Morning. Health Talks at Cathie's. Ltd., Aspro. Ltd., and Wellington Woollen Mills. Afternoon. 12.30 to 1.30, Community Sing, Town Hall. Health Talks at St. Patrick's Collego, Kirlicaiaie and Stains, and Whitcombe and Tombs. :i p.m., Dietary Talk and Demonstration by Miss Rennic, Cookery Boom, Technical College, Mercer street. Evening. Town Hall: Chairman, Mr. Marcus Marks. Lecture: "Worry the Disease of the Age." 'Entertainment: Mrs. Myers's Concert Party. Lecture: "Parental Control," Key. T. i\ielden Taylor. Jupp's Band. Pull programme to bo broadcasted by Kadio Broadcast Company of .New Zealand.
